About Candelaria C. Sánchez‐Mateo

Candelaria C. Sánchez‐Mateo is a scholar working on Sensory Systems, Plant Science and Pharmacology, having authored 21 papers that have together received 576 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Phytochemistry and Biological Activities (12 papers), Natural Compound Pharmacology Studies (10 papers) and Biological and pharmacological studies of plants (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biological Psychiatry (31 citations), Complementary and alternative medicine (84 citations) and Plant Science (371 citations). Candelaria C. Sánchez‐Mateo has collaborated with scholars based in Spain, Italy and Paraguay. Frequent co-authors include Rosa M. Rabanal, M. Hernández‐Pérez, V. Darias, Á. Arias, Filippo Maggi, Massimo Bramucci, Luana Quassinti, Giulio Lupidi, Fabrizio Papa and Dezemona Petrelli.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Ethnopharmacology, Bioorganic & Medicinal Chemistry and Phytotherapy Research.
